Ordinals
beta
Sat 745652909801347
decimal
149130.2909801347
degree
0°149130′1962″2909801347‴
percentile
35.507281458169786%
name
ioklwgiboxa
cycle
0
epoch
0
period
73
block
149130
offset
2909801347
timestamp
2011-10-13 14:03:39 UTC
rarity
common
prev
next